Poet and Nobel Laureate (1945) Gabriela Mistral was born Lucila Godoy y Alcayaga in Vicuña, Chile, in 1889. Mistral was an active member of the League of Nations and served as Chilean consul in Italy, Spain, and Portugal. She taught Spanish literature in the United States at Columbia University, Barnard College, and Vassar College, and at the University of Puerto Rico. Her works include Desolación, Ternura, and Tala. She died in 1957.

Letters and manuscripts, 1911-1949 (2 inches), of Chilean poet and Nobel Laureate Gabriela Mistral. In one folder and three thin bound volumes, the Gabriela Mistral Papers include letters (1911-1923) of Mistral (writing as Lucila Godoy) to poet Antonio Bórquez Solar; letters (1937-1949) of Mistral to Guillermo de Torre and his wife Norah Borges (sister of Jorge Luis Borges); and two typed manuscript essays: the epistle "Respuesta a un Manifiesto de Españoles" (1935), and "Calpe-Argentina y el Libro Español en la América" (n.d.).
